Abstract

The invention discloses a wheel diameter measuring instrument for locomotives and vehicles, which comprises an upright frame, the two sides of the frame are provided with measuring instrument positioning surfaces perpendicular to the horizontal line, and the lower part of the front side of the frame is provided with an angle Measuring instrument, the left and right sides of the upper part of the frame are symmetrically provided with positioning pins with the angle measuring instrument as the center, the positioning pins protrude from the measuring instrument positioning surface of the frame, and the upper end of the angle measuring instrument is connected to the machine. The front part of the frame is connected with a swing rod, and the swing rod is installed with a linear grating ruler through a slider that slides up and down along the swing rod and a linear grating ruler mounting seat, and the top of the linear grating ruler mounting seat protrudes from the frame. A measuring head arm is provided on the rear side of the measuring head arm, and a downward measuring head is provided at the tail end of the measuring head arm. The invention can solve the problem that the structure of the existing locomotive wheel is complex, and the space for measuring the diameter of the wheel without dropping the wheel is small and the problem of great difficulty in measurement is solved.

Description

technical field [0001] The invention relates to the technical field of manufacturing measuring instruments for locomotives, in particular to a measuring instrument for wheel diameters of locomotive wheels in the state of not being unloaded. Background technique [0002] With the increasing speed of railway operation year by year, in order to ensure the safety of railway transportation, the relevant railway departments have made stricter regulations on the wheel diameter difference of the same wheel set and the same bogie of different types of rolling stock. Perform non-drop wheel spin repairs, that is, perform rotary repairs without removing the wheelset. The increase in running speed makes the structure of the bogie more complex, and the space for measuring the wheel diameter without dropping the wheel is smaller, making the measurement more and more difficult.
